Short Description

Resident expert on creating and maintaining the Patient Experience.

Member of the Revenue Cycle and Geographic Hub leadership team. Works collaboratively with physicians, clinical staff and administrative leadership team within institutes and departments, including Health Care Access, call center, revenue cycle, quality, finance.

Manages and coordinates administrative and clinical services for five to eight physician office sites. Collaborates and maintains standardized work procedures and policies to improve efficiency and effectiveness across Institues in multiple ambulatory offices.

Responsible for the management of clinical and business operations of assigned geographical hub, including, but not limited to: delivery of clinical services, revenue cycle (from patient scheduling through charge capture and reimbursement for services), accounts payable, materials management, medical record compliance, software implementations, regulatory compliance, equipment maintenance, environment of care, and facility management.

Supports the strategic direction of the Vice President of Ambulatory Operations and the Institute’s growth playbook by operationalizing new programs and growth initiatives.
